Spent several hours on the lake yesterday and finding and catching fish was even harder than it has been. I eeked out 21 including some magnum white bass, short hybrids and a legal hybrid. Substantial moonlight I think made them less hungry in the AM. As promised here are two screen shots of the pattern I am looking for for whites on 12 to 18 fow structures right now. This on shows a few fish on bottom close to one another. This is really what I'm looking for - continuous fish hugging the bottom. If these fish stayed put, I could sit there and catch a limit. But, they move around. Note this shot left side is X2 magnification of bottom portion of column:
